Minutes — Management Meeting, Training Budget

Present: J. Marlowe (chair), F. Edden, S. Korval.

The committee reviewed next year's training allocation in detail. Agreed: a 6% uplift, weighted toward the Bramfield service teams, with certifications prioritised over conferences. Finance to confirm phasing by month-end. The board should note the confidential rationale recorded immediately below.

board note of kageg-bahof: The renewal with Holwynax Holdings closes at $2 million a year, 5 percent below the last contract. Project Ulaath slips by two quarters because of the supplier delay.

Runbook fragment: Slabview diff viewer, large-file handling. When a customer reports the diff pane hanging or showing a truncation banner, it usually means the file exceeds the streaming threshold and the chunked renderer has kicked in. First verify the worker pool is healthy and the temp volume has free space, then compare the instance's live settings against the baseline. The expected baseline configuration for the diff service is as follows.

deployment values, kajep-kageg:
[praix]
host = praix.paliqcorp.corp
user = praix_svc
database = praix_prod

# Data Stores — Pulsegate Firmware Channel

The Pulsegate update channel serves signed firmware bundles to Larkspur devices. Metadata (versions, rollout percentages, device cohorts) lives in the `fwchan` Postgres cluster; binaries sit in the Ostrand blob store. Release promotions write a row to `channel_releases` — do not edit this table by hand. Rollbacks are handled by flipping `active_version`, never by deleting rows. The release tooling reads its credentials at startup; for manual verification, connect using the string below.

replica DSN, kajep-yahag: mssql://praok_svc:iF@db-8d68.plorvaio.local:5432/eliion

**FAQ: Why does the Fernhollow greenhouse controller report sensor drift?**

For reviewers: the Fernhollow K2 controller recalibrates humidity and temperature probes every six hours. Drift beyond 2% triggers a quarantine state, during which readings are logged but not acted upon. This prevents a compromised probe from driving actuators. Manual recalibration requires operator authorization on the local panel. To release a quarantined probe during audit, the operator supplies the recovery passphrase shown below.

unlock words, kagef-taduf: fenir-quenix-norwyn-sorvan-gormir-gorir-fraok